Explore the magnificent mountain range on this multi-day trekking tour.
We begin with a drive from Huaraz to Cashapampa 2800 m. We meet our donkey drivers, load all equipment onto the donkeys and start trekking. We hike continuously upwards following the Santa Cruz River. First we are in a narrow canyon and then after lunch, the country opens up into a wider valley and we start to see the snow covered peaks. We camp in an open field near the river at Llamacorral.
The next day will be an easier day hiking in a wide-open valley. We pass by two small lakes and then we have our first glimpse of the famous Alpamayo Peak. We camp at Taullipampa, at 4250 m, a beautiful campsite surrounded by towering peaks and nestled near the bottom of Punta Union Pass. For an extra day of adventure, we can stay another night at the beautiful Taullipampa campsite. We can visit Alpamayo Base Camp, Lake Arhuaycocha and climb Centillo Peak, or have a rest day.
In the morning, we climb steadily up for 2 to 3 hours to the Pass Punta Union at 4750 m. We then descend past a small alpine lake where we often stop for picnic lunch. Continue the descent towards the Huaripampa Valley before leaving the main trail and traversing through low bush to our camp in a secluded valley away from the main trail at Paria at 3850 m.
Our last day will see us follow easily down the valley of Quebrada Huaripampa, passing through farming settlements and villages and then a short climb to the road end at Vaqueria 4 to 5 hours walk. Our private van will take us over the pass of Portuchuelo 4767 m, passing the famous Llangunuco Lakes and then to return to Huaraz.
